Household of James Wards (born 1842, Orkney)

1881 England, Wales & Scotland Census in Fordoun, Kincardineshire, Scotland

In the 1881 Census, the household of James Wards, born in 1842 in Cross, Orkney, consisted of 6 members. James was the head of the household, married to Mary Findlater, born in 1849 in Aberdeenshire, Scotland. They had 4 children; William (born 1871 in Fordoun, Kincardineshire, Scotland), John (born 1874 in Fordoun, Kincardineshire, Scotland), James (born 1876 in Laurencekirk, Kincardineshire, Scotland) and Catherine (born 1881 in Fordoun, Kincardineshire, Scotland).
